I replaced the "Brička 001" with new ones, size 225*45*17. Compared to the "Brička", they are much softer and create less noise. They don't follow the ruts. In the rain, you obviously need to drive carefully, I wouldn't fully trust it. Going 130 km/h on the Kyiv-Kharkiv highway, during rain and a gentle turn, passing through a puddle 1-2 cm deep, I almost lost control (on new tires). In the rain, it's better not to go over 100 km/h, in this regard the "Brička 001" is better. Confident handling at high speeds on dry surfaces, doesn't catch ruts. Despite its softness, it is quite durable; I hit the Ukrainian lunar landscape several times, thought my fillings would fall out, but no bumps appeared. Moderate handling on wet surfaces. No issues at city speeds, but I won't risk it at over a hundred on wet roads. use Continental ContiPremiumContact 6 225/45 R17 91V few months |

I was looking for options for a car with pneumatic suspension and previously found heaps of options including cheap Chinese ones that rumble like a train, feeling almost square, and let's not even talk about balancing. As for Continental, everything is just perfect. On the road, especially when warmed up, they make no noise at all—you just drive and forget. Regarding the braking distance, everything is spot on despite the tires being soft with an asymmetric tread pattern. As for aquaplaning, it’s a debatable point: if you speed into a corner with water, nothing will help, but if you use them normally and don’t push them beyond limits, they will perform well and you won’t need to fear wet conditions. The sidewalls are soft yet strong; there is a side cut, but no bulge appeared. At temperatures around 4-5 degrees, the rubber becomes noticeably hard and noisy, so I recommend changing it for winter in time to avoid unexpected issues on the road. |
In the premium line of summer tyres from Continental, one of the best offers is rightfully considered the ContiPremiumContact 6 model, which combines refined sports handling and ride comfort.
Omnivorous qualities
The omnivorous qualities of the tyre to different types of roadway under the wheels of a vehicle are determined by the use of an elastic Black Chilli rubber compound with a high content of silica. The tyre tenaciously clings to dry and wet roads in all weather conditions of the warm season. The model also demonstrates excellent acceleration and braking efficiency.
Pronounced asymmetry
The tread of the Continental ContiPremiumContact 6 has a pronounced asymmetric structure. The long shoulder blocks of the tread support each other and are resistant to high side loads, which allows you to calmly lay dashing turns. And the trio of central stiffening ribs increases the directional stability of the car when moving at high speeds.
Driving comfort
Of the controversial points, the models note sidewalls that are sensitive to damage and the average resistance of the tyre to transverse aquaplaning. However, in terms of the last parameter, the rubber is second only to the flagship counterparts - in comparison with any other middle-level and budget-class tyre, Continental ContiPremiumContact 6 is out of competition. In addition , the tyre will please the car owner with a long mileage until the tread pattern wears out, comfort and quiet running.
